George Beeron is a Girramay Traditional Owner. He is based in the Jumbun Aboriginal Community of the Murray Upper area, North-West of Cardwell, Queensland.  George is an expert ceramicist. He specialises in the design of Bigin bowls and Bagu sculptures. George is known to use an array of colors and designs throughout his work. His mix of both vivid and muted tones gives each piece a distinguishable touch. George produces pieces that reflect his close connection to country, culture, family and contemporary living. Due to his refined artistry and vast portfolio, many of George’s larger than life artworks have been purchased and acquired for exhibition.
